Word of the Day – Churlish

By December 2, 2016Word of the Day

Churlish (adj)

chur-li-sh

Rude in a mean-spirited and surly way.

Taken from Churl a mean spirited person which comes from the old English ceorl, of West Germanic origin; related to Dutch kerel and German Kerl or – fellow.

Example sentences

“Throughout his life his conduct was unpleasant and churlish.”

“He invited me to dinner and I thought it would be churlish to refuse.”
